Determining the unbounded potential in the two-dimensional Schrödinger equation from Cauchy data
Abstract
We prove a uniqueness result for determining an unbounded potential in the two-dimensional Schrödinger equation using the corresponding Dirichlet-to-Neumann map. Our proof relies on a specific Carleman inequality. We also provide a quantitative version of the uniqueness result.
